11. OK, Hurricane 101 - lesson 1
The word "hurricane" has it's origins in the language of the Caribe aboriginals (pre-colombian inhabitants of the Carribean), and then was adopted into spanish and english languages.

16. Live feed is showing all water, seawall covered
http://www.khou.com/video/?nvid=178826&live=yes&noad=yes

Has good live stream coverage.

The reporter at the scene said the only way you know there IS a seawall there is when a wave looks extra bumpy (as it passes over the seawall that is under the water)
